Transaction 70ac0e83bead7878b38316a92419066228ca35f4f255fd2a688a7914380a3736

7 Input
2 Outputs
  • 70ac0e83bead7878b38316a92419066228ca35f4f255fd2a688a7914380a3736:0
  • value  2840
    address  1PK35fo8cDHkdQWuuw4tEWqbVc6hSDebze
  • 70ac0e83bead7878b38316a92419066228ca35f4f255fd2a688a7914380a3736:1
  • value  3480000
    address  1AFfbtFG9Emwpo7x5ViCeFbt4811Pd1HW8